Program Top Fives: Basketball
Please note this is only since the 2010-11 season.
Assists
1. 573 (CJ Wilson)
2. 522 (Lauren Smith)
3. 483 (Brian Harper)
4. 381 (Vince Martin)
5. 226 (Steve Viterbo)
*Rising junior Kalen Surles is sixth with 211
Steals
1. 252 (Lauren Smith)
T2. 190 (CJ Wilson/Ladondra Johnson)
4. 164 (Bryson Robertson)
5. 162 (Steve Viterbo)
Blocks
1. 112 (Bryson Robertson)
2. 80 (Marcellus Roberts)
3. 75 (Ladondra Johnson)
4. 67 (Kevin Altidor)
T5. 65 (Jenny Vernet/Kaycee Cash)
Games Started
T1. 98 (Lauren Smith/Shereese Williams)
3. 91 (Steve Viterbo)
4. 90 (Ladondra Johnson)
5. 84 (CJ Wilson)
Offensive Rebounds
1. 252 (Ladondra Johnson)
T2. 239 (Jenny Vernet/Shereese Williams)
4. 233 (Bjorn Walker)
5. 203 (Kaycee Cash)
Defensive Rebounds
1. 506 (Ladondra Johnson)
2. 417 (Bjorn Walker)
3. 396 (Bryson Robertson)
4. 382 (CJ Wilson)
5. 359 (Steve Viterbo)
*Rising senior Mackenzie Johnson is sixth with 349
Free Throws
1. 490 (CJ Wilson)
2. 471 (Frank Adams)
3. 262 (Brian Harper)
4. 227 (Lauren Smith)
5. 217 (Vince Martin)
Three-Pointers
1. 221 (Seth McCoy)
2. 216 (CJ Wilson)
3. 185 (Carly Winters)
4. 169 (Keta Robinette)
5. 145 (Briana Bell)
Field Goals
1. 698 (Ladondra Johnson)
2. 636 (CJ Wilson)
3. 504 (Frank Adams)
4. 373 (Steve Viterbo)
5. 372 (Lauren Smith)
